diff --git a/src/vs/workbench/contrib/terminal/browser/terminalInstance.ts b/src/vs/workbench/contrib/terminal/browser/terminalInstance.ts index e8bfa083279..e82b8b87416 100644 --- a/src/vs/workbench/contrib/terminal/browser/terminalInstance.ts +++ b/src/vs/workbench/contrib/terminal/browser/terminalInstance.ts @@ -423,7 +423,7 @@ export class TerminalInstance extends Disposable implements ITerminalInstance { fastScrollModifier: 'alt', fastScrollSensitivity: editorOptions.fastScrollSensitivity, scrollSensitivity: editorOptions.mouseWheelScrollSensitivity, - rendererType: config.rendererType === 'auto' || config.rendererType === 'experimentalWebgl' ? 'dom' : config.rendererType, + rendererType: config.rendererType === 'auto' || config.rendererType === 'experimentalWebgl' ? 'canvas' : config.rendererType, wordSeparator: config.wordSeparators }); this._xterm = xterm; @@ -1333,7 +1333,7 @@ export class TerminalInstance extends Disposable implements ITerminalInstance { this._xterm.loadAddon(this._webglAddon); } catch { this._disposeOfWebglRenderer(); - this._safeSetOption('rendererType', 'dom'); + this._safeSetOption('rendererType', 'canvas'); } }